/* -*- Mode: C++; tab-width: 2; indent-tabs-mode: nil; c-basic-offset: 2 -*- */
/*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/. */
#include "gtest/gtest.h"
#include "MP4Demuxer.h"
#include "mozilla/MozPromise.h"
#include "MediaDataDemuxer.h"
#include "mozilla/SharedThreadPool.h"
#include "mozilla/TaskQueue.h"
#include "mozilla/ArrayUtils.h"
#include "mozilla/Unused.h"
#include "MockMediaResource.h"
#include "VideoUtils.h"
using namespace mozilla;
using media::TimeUnit;
#define DO_FAIL \
[binding]() -> void { \
EXPECT_TRUE(false); \
binding->mTaskQueue->BeginShutdown(); \
}
class MP4DemuxerBinding {
public:
NS_INLINE_DECL_THREADSAFE_REFCOUNTING(MP4DemuxerBinding);
RefPtr<MockMediaResource> resource;
RefPtr<MP4Demuxer> mDemuxer;
RefPtr<TaskQueue> mTaskQueue;
RefPtr<MediaTrackDemuxer> mAudioTrack;
RefPtr<MediaTrackDemuxer> mVideoTrack;
uint32_t mIndex;
nsTArray<RefPtr<MediaRawData>> mSamples;
nsTArray<int64_t> mKeyFrameTimecodes;
MozPromiseHolder<GenericPromise> mCheckTrackKeyFramePromise;
MozPromiseHolder<GenericPromise> mCheckTrackSamples;
explicit MP4DemuxerBinding(const char* aFileName = "dash_dashinit.mp4")
: resource(new MockMediaResource(aFileName)),
mDemuxer(new MP4Demuxer(resource)),
mTaskQueue(TaskQueue::Create(
GetMediaThreadPool(MediaThreadType::SUPERVISOR), "TestMP4Demuxer")),
mIndex(0) {
EXPECT_EQ(NS_OK, resource->Open());
}
template <typename Function>
void RunTestAndWait(const Function& aFunction) {
Function func(aFunction);
RefPtr<MP4DemuxerBinding> binding = this;
mDemuxer->Init()->Then(mTaskQueue, __func__, std::move(func), DO_FAIL);
mTaskQueue->AwaitShutdownAndIdle();
}
RefPtr<GenericPromise> CheckTrackKeyFrame(MediaTrackDemuxer* aTrackDemuxer) {
MOZ_RELEASE_ASSERT(mTaskQueue->IsCurrentThreadIn());
RefPtr<MediaTrackDemuxer> track = aTrackDemuxer;
RefPtr<MP4DemuxerBinding> binding = this;
auto time = TimeUnit::Invalid();
while (mIndex < mSamples.Length()) {
uint32_t i = mIndex++;
if (mSamples[i]->mKeyframe) {
time = mSamples[i]->mTime;
break;
}
}
RefPtr<GenericPromise> p = mCheckTrackKeyFramePromise.Ensure(__func__);
if (!time.IsValid()) {
mCheckTrackKeyFramePromise.Resolve(true, __func__);
return p;
}
DispatchTask([track, time, binding]() {
track->Seek(time)->Then(
binding->mTaskQueue, __func__,
[track, time, binding]() {
track->GetSamples()->Then(
binding->mTaskQueue, __func__,
[track, time,
binding](RefPtr<MediaTrackDemuxer::SamplesHolder> aSamples) {
EXPECT_EQ(time, aSamples->GetSamples()[0]->mTime);
binding->CheckTrackKeyFrame(track);
},
DO_FAIL);
},
DO_FAIL);
});
return p;
}
RefPtr<GenericPromise> CheckTrackSamples(MediaTrackDemuxer* aTrackDemuxer) {
MOZ_RELEASE_ASSERT(mTaskQueue->IsCurrentThreadIn());
RefPtr<MediaTrackDemuxer> track = aTrackDemuxer;
RefPtr<MP4DemuxerBinding> binding = this;
RefPtr<GenericPromise> p = mCheckTrackSamples.Ensure(__func__);
DispatchTask([track, binding]() {
track->GetSamples()->Then(
binding->mTaskQueue, __func__,
[track, binding](RefPtr<MediaTrackDemuxer::SamplesHolder> aSamples) {
if (aSamples->GetSamples().Length()) {
binding->mSamples.AppendElements(aSamples->GetSamples());
binding->CheckTrackSamples(track);
}
},
[binding](const MediaResult& aError) {
if (aError == NS_ERROR_DOM_MEDIA_END_OF_STREAM) {
EXPECT_TRUE(binding->mSamples.Length() > 1);
for (uint32_t i = 0; i < (binding->mSamples.Length() - 1); i++) {
EXPECT_LT(binding->mSamples[i]->mTimecode,
binding->mSamples[i + 1]->mTimecode);
if (binding->mSamples[i]->mKeyframe) {
binding->mKeyFrameTimecodes.AppendElement(
binding->mSamples[i]->mTimecode.ToMicroseconds());
}
}
binding->mCheckTrackSamples.Resolve(true, __func__);
} else {
EXPECT_TRUE(false);
binding->mCheckTrackSamples.Reject(aError, __func__);
}
});
});
return p;
}
private:
template <typename FunctionType>
void DispatchTask(FunctionType aFun) {
RefPtr<Runnable> r =
NS_NewRunnableFunction("MP4DemuxerBinding::DispatchTask", aFun);
Unused << mTaskQueue->Dispatch(r.forget());
}
virtual ~MP4DemuxerBinding() = default;
};
TEST(MP4Demuxer, Seek)
{
RefPtr<MP4DemuxerBinding> binding = new MP4DemuxerBinding();
binding->RunTestAndWait([binding]() {
binding->mVideoTrack =
binding->mDemuxer->GetTrackDemuxer(TrackInfo::kVideoTrack, 0);
binding->CheckTrackSamples(binding->mVideoTrack)
->Then(
binding->mTaskQueue, __func__,
[binding]() {
binding->CheckTrackKeyFrame(binding->mVideoTrack)
->Then(
binding->mTaskQueue, __func__,
[binding]() { binding->mTaskQueue->BeginShutdown(); },
DO_FAIL);
},
DO_FAIL);
});
}

TEST(MP4Demuxer, GetNextKeyframe)
{
RefPtr<MP4DemuxerBinding> binding = new MP4DemuxerBinding("gizmo-frag.mp4");
binding->RunTestAndWait([binding]() {
// Insert a [0,end] buffered range, to simulate Moof's being buffered
// via MSE.
auto len = binding->resource->GetLength();
binding->resource->MockAddBufferedRange(0, len);
// gizmp-frag has two keyframes; one at dts=cts=0, and another at
// dts=cts=1000000. Verify we get expected results.
TimeUnit time;
binding->mVideoTrack =
binding->mDemuxer->GetTrackDemuxer(TrackInfo::kVideoTrack, 0);
binding->mVideoTrack->Reset();
binding->mVideoTrack->GetNextRandomAccessPoint(&time);
EXPECT_EQ(time.ToMicroseconds(), 0);
binding->mVideoTrack->GetSamples()->Then(
binding->mTaskQueue, __func__,
[binding]() {
TimeUnit time;
binding->mVideoTrack->GetNextRandomAccessPoint(&time);
EXPECT_EQ(time.ToMicroseconds(), 1000000);
binding->mTaskQueue->BeginShutdown();
},
DO_FAIL);
});
}
TEST(MP4Demuxer, ZeroInLastMoov)
{
RefPtr<MP4DemuxerBinding> binding =
new MP4DemuxerBinding("short-zero-in-moov.mp4");
binding->RunTestAndWait([binding]() {
// It demuxes without error. That is sufficient.
binding->mTaskQueue->BeginShutdown();
});
}
TEST(MP4Demuxer, ZeroInMoovQuickTime)
{
RefPtr<MP4DemuxerBinding> binding =
new MP4DemuxerBinding("short-zero-inband.mov");
binding->RunTestAndWait([binding]() {
// It demuxes without error. That is sufficient.
binding->mTaskQueue->BeginShutdown();
});
}
TEST(MP4Demuxer, IgnoreMinus1Duration)
{
RefPtr<MP4DemuxerBinding> binding =
new MP4DemuxerBinding("negative_duration.mp4");
binding->RunTestAndWait([binding]() {
// It demuxes without error. That is sufficient.
binding->mTaskQueue->BeginShutdown();
});
}
#undef DO_FAIL
